Why do circuit boards need coating protection?

Protective coatings are used to enhance the performance and reliability of printed circuit board assembly, enabling it to be applied in harsh environments such as underwater, aerospace, and military applications. Manufacturers of electronic consumer products are increasingly using protective coatings as an economical way to improve product reliability.

The protective coating is a plastic film wrapped around the printed circuit assembly board, with a thickness of 0 005in, it seals dust and environmental pollutants outside the circuit board.

 

The function of the protective coating is as follows:

 

1. Protect the circuit from extreme environments and prevent it from being affected by moisture, bacteria, dust, and rust;
2. Prevent damage to the circuit board during production, assembly, and use, reduce mechanical stress on components, and protect them from thermal oscillation;
3. Reduce wear and tear during use;
4. As the protective coating increases the insulation strength between conductors, it enhances the performance of the circuit board and allows for greater component density.
